60% of Brazilian voters would vote for a gay presidential candidate -poll

R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L - A survey by Atlas, published exclusively by EL PAÍS, also shows that for 24% of respondents, voting for a homosexual candidate is unthinkable and that women are more progressive in this regard than men.

In Brazil, one of the countries where most LGBTQIA+ people are killed in the world - with an estimated one victim of homophobia every 23 hours - 60% of voters say they would vote for an openly gay candidate for the presidency of the Republic.
